Having said it's an understandable development however; it's not the way crowdfunding is designed to work - it's not supposed to be payment by proxy, but funded by the crowd. Large numbers of investors contributing small amounts.

This is why crowdfunding's pretty difficult to do well in the SHiP market - by its very nature SHiP is a niche, and so the number of contributors is instantly limited. To do it properly you need to appeal to the mainstream, but then the vids would have to do without being 50% strangulation scene.

Which would actually appeal to less SHiP fans most likely - somewhat of a catch-22.


Patreon seems the best way to go if you are looking to crowdfund, simply make it a subscription service with varying rates - harking back to the old DanO days, but with a more modern twist.

I could see it working, whether enough SHiP fans trust Bluestone productions to go for it I couldn't say. Judging by apparent sales volumes however, making Bluestone vids exclusive to the Patreon would likely pull in quite a few frequent subscribers.

swampy170 wrote:

Patreon seems the best way to go if you are looking to crowdfund, simply make it a subscription service with varying rates - harking back to the old DanO days, but with a more modern twist.
That might not be an option for him either.
I started a Patreon offering movies for as low as $1
and while a few have joined and pledged, many have not bothered.
What is odd is that over 90% of my clicks and sales come from C4S. the analytics say so right there in the admin section.

People seem not to want to pledge $1 on a sight unseen project but will pay $1 a minute for something they see.
I can't tell you how surprised i was to see the pattern movie that was offered for $1 actually sell for full price on C4S when the majority of the clicks come from this forum.

I don't know exactly why its happening but there you have it.
I started a sleepy, death, and Superheroine Patreon and the sleepy and death (which were launched after the super heroine) are doing 3-4 times better than the super heroine which was originally built to give large projects away for small pledges.

I wish him luck, but don't see how Patreon is an option when 90% of my super heroine sales come from this forum but people would rather pay $1 a minute than $1 a month.
